To run RaceMenu on Skyrim Special Edition (SSE) version 1.5.97, you must use specific legacy versions of the mod and its requirements. The newer "Anniversary Edition" (AE) versions of these mods are not backward compatible and will cause the game to crash or fail to load the menu. Core Version Requirements

For game version 1.5.97, install the following specific files: RaceMenu: You need Version 0.4.16 (released Oct 4, 2020).

SKSE64: Use Version 2.0.17 or 2.0.19, which are designated for runtime 1.5.97.

SkyUI: The standard SkyUI SE version 5.2 is required for the interface to function. Critical Fixes for 1.5.97

Memory Leak Hotfix: Version 0.4.16 of RaceMenu has a known memory leak that can cause crashes during extended gameplay. It is highly recommended to install the RaceMenu 0.4.16 Memory Leak Hotfix alongside the main mod. "RaceMenu

Backported Extended ESL Support: If you use newer mods alongside your 1.5.97 setup, install the Backported Extended ESL Support mod to prevent crashes related to newer file formats (version 1.71) used by the game's latest updates. Installation Steps

Install SKSE64: Manually extract the SKSE64 files into your Skyrim root folder (where SkyrimSE.exe is located).

Mod Manager Setup: Use a manager like Mod Organizer 2 or Vortex to install SkyUI followed by RaceMenu v0.4.16.

Clean Up Conflicts: If the RaceMenu sliders do not appear in-game, check Data/Interface and delete the file racesex_menu.swf if it exists outside of the mod's archived files, as it may be a leftover from a vanilla-style overhaul mod.
